What is a VP Data Center Operations job?

A VP of Data Center Operations is responsible for overseeing the day-to-day and long-term management of data center facilities, ensuring optimal performance, security, and efficiency. They develop and implement strategies for infrastructure reliability, disaster recovery, and compliance with industry standards. Additionally, they manage budgets, lead teams, and collaborate with other executives to align data center operations with business objectives. Their role is critical in maintaining uptime, optimizing resources, and supporting an organization's IT and digital transformation needs.

What are the biggest challenges faced by a VP of Data Center Operations, and how should candidates be prepared to handle them?

One of the biggest challenges in this role is ensuring maximum uptime and business continuity while managing rapidly evolving technologies and increasing expectations for energy efficiency. Candidates should be adept at proactively identifying and mitigating risks, managing large-scale teams, and developing contingency plans to address issues such as power outages, cyber threats, and facility maintenance. Success often depends on strong cross-functional collaboration with IT, security, engineering, and executive leadership. Being prepared to respond rapidly to incidents, implement best industry practices, and continuously drive operational improvements is key to excelling in this dynamic and mission-critical position.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Vp Data Center Operations position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a VP Data Center Operations, you need extensive experience in data center management, IT infrastructure, and leadership, often supported by a degree in information technology or engineering. Familiarity with data center management platforms, network monitoring tools, and certifications like Uptime Institute Accredited Tier Designer or Certified Data Centre Professional (CDCP) is highly valuable. Excellent strategic thinking, crisis management, and communication skills distinguish successful leaders in this position. These abilities are crucial for ensuring uninterrupted operations, optimizing resources, and leading diverse technical teams in highly demanding environments.

About the job
Google isn't just a software company. The Hardware Operations team is responsible for monitoring the state-of-the-art physical infrastructure behind Google's powerful search technology. As a Hardware Operations Manager, you will manage a team of Data Center Technicians. You will oversee the quality installation of server hardware and components and take charge of complicated installations/troubleshooting.
Your team will install, configure, test, troubleshoot and maintain hardware (like servers and its components) and server software (like Google's Linux cluster). They will also take on the configuration of more complex components such as networks, routers, hubs, bridges, switches and networking protocols. They may lead small project teams on larger installations and develop project contingency plans.
Google's groundbreaking search technology relies on a cutting-edge infrastructure, and the Server Operations team ensures it all runs smoothly.
As a Server Operations Manager, you'll lead a team of skilled Data Center Technicians who are the backbone of this operation. You'll guide the team in the installation and maintenance of server hardware, networking equipment, and their components, all while troubleshooting challenges head-on. The team will be skilled in configuring and maintaining not just servers, but the entire network ecosystem - routers, switches, and the protocols that connect them all. You'll assist and ensure complex projects are navigated by removing road blocks and developing plans to keep things running efficiently.
In this role, you'll be key to the success of the data center, proactively monitoring performance, anticipating potential issues, and collaborating closely with the area lead, site manager, peer OMs, and partnering teams like DCOps, Security, and GSO-L to ensure optimal operational efficiency.
